Thus, don't do it too often. Keep your car running as clean as possible so you don't have to do this slightly damaging cleaning all the time. And most importantly, after a good intake and combustion cleaning, change your engine oil.
If well maintained, and not under severe conditions, once every other year is more than enough. If under severe conditions (short drives, especially in cold weather, dirty gas, bad plugs, bad pcv, cheap engine oil, connected crankcase ventilation, etc) once a year is plenty.
